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2023-05-04 Committee on ENERGY, UTILITIES AND TECHNOLOGY suggested and ordered printed REFERENCE to the Committee on ENERGY, UTILITIES AND TECHNOLOGY Ordered sent down forthwith for concurrence
  • 2023-05-04 The Bill was REFERRED to the Committee on ENERGY, UTILITIES AND TECHNOLOGY. referral-committee
  • 2023-05-04 In concurrence. ORDERED SENT FORTHWITH.
  • 2023-06-22 Reports READ
  • 2023-06-22 On motion by Senator LAWRENCE of York The Majority Ought to Pass As Amended Report ACCEPTED
  • 2023-06-22 Roll Call Ordered Roll Call Number 442 Yeas 20 - Nays 13 - Excused 2 - Absent 0 PREVAILED
  • 2023-06-22 READ ONCE reading-1
  • 2023-06-22 Committee Amendment "A" (S-420) READ and ADOPTED committ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-06-22 Under suspension of the Rules, READ A SECOND TIME and PASSED TO BE ENGROSSED AS AMENDED by Committee Amendment "A" (S-420) reading-2, reading-3
  • 2023-06-22 Sent down for concurrence
  • 2023-06-22 Reports READ.
  • 2023-06-22 On motion of Representative ZEIGLER of Montville, the Majority Ought to Pass as Amended Report was ACCEPTED.
  • 2023-06-22 ROLL CALL NO. 311
  • 2023-06-22 (Yeas 74 - Nays 68 - Absent 8 - Excused 1)
  • 2023-06-22 The Bill was READ ONCE. reading-1
  • 2023-06-22 Committee Amendment "A" (S-420) was READ and ADOPTED. committee-passage-favorable, passage
  • 2023-06-22 Under suspension of the rules, the Bill was given its SECOND READING without REFERENCE to the Committee on Bills in the Second Reading.
  • 2023-06-22 The Bill was PASSED TO BE ENGROSSED as Amended by Committee Amendment "A" (S-420). reading-3
  • 2023-06-22 In concurrence. ORDERED SENT FORTHWITH.
  • 2023-06-23 PASSED TO BE ENACTED. passage
  • 2023-06-23 ROLL CALL NO. 327
  • 2023-06-23 (Yeas 72 - Nays 55 - Absent 24 - Excused 0)
  • 2023-06-23 Sent for concurrence. ORDERED SENT FORTHWITH.
  • 2023-06-23 On motion by Senator ROTUNDO of Androscoggin Tabled until Later in Today's Session, pending PASSAGE TO BE ENACTED, in concurrence.
  • 2023-06-23 Taken from the table by the President
  • 2023-06-23 On motion by Senator ROTUNDO of Androscoggin PLACED ON THE SPECIAL APPROPRIATIONS TABLE pending PASSAGE TO BE ENACTED in concurrence
  • 2023-07-25 On Motion by Senator ROTUNDO of Androscoggin taken from the SPECIAL APPROPRIATIONS TABLE.
  • 2023-07-25 Under suspension of the Rules On motion by Same Senator The Senate RECONSIDERED whereby the Bill was PASSED TO BE ENGROSSED AS AMENDED BY Committee Amendment "A" (S-420) reading-3
  • 2023-07-25 Under further suspension of the Rules On further motion by Same Senator The Senate RECONSIDERED whereby Committee Amendment "A" (S-420) was ADOPTED committ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-07-25 On further motion by Same Senator Senate Amendment "A" (S-503) to Committee Amendment "A" (S-420) READ
  • 2023-07-25 Senator BENNETT of Oxford moved to Bill and accompanying papers COMMITTED to the Committee on Energy, Utilities and Technology
  • 2023-07-25 Roll Call Ordered Roll Call Number 487 Yeas 8 - Nays 19 - Excused 8 - Absent 0 FAILED
  • 2023-07-25 Senate Amendment "A" (S-503) to Committee Amendment "A" (S-420) ADOPTED committ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-07-25 Roll Call Ordered Roll Call Number 488 Yeas 19 - Nays 8 - Excused 8 - Absent 0 PREVAILED
  • 2023-07-25 Committee Amendment "A" (S-420) as Amended by Senate Amendment "A" (S-503) thereto ADOPTED committ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-07-25 PASSED TO BE ENGROSSED AS AMENDED BY Committee Amendment "A" (S-420) AS AMENDED BY Senate Amendment "A" (S-503) thereto In NON-CONCURRENCE reading-3
  • 2023-07-25 Ordered sent down forthwith for concurrence
  • 2023-07-25 The House RECEDED and CONCURRED to PASSAGE TO BE ENGROSSED as Amended by Committee Amendment "A" (S-420) as Amended by Senate Amendment "A" (S-503) thereto. reading-3
  • 2023-07-25 ROLL CALL NO. 357
  • 2023-07-25 (Yeas 59 - Nays 40 - Absent 51 - Excused 0 - Vacant 1)
  • 2023-07-25 ORDERED SENT FORTHWITH.
  • 2023-07-26 PASSED TO BE ENACTED. passage
  • 2023-07-26 Sent for concurrence. ORDERED SENT FORTHWITH.
  • 2023-07-26 PASSED TO BE ENACTED, in concurrence. passage
  • 2023-07-27 Signed by Governor executive-signature
